Just a cherry pie! A simple, basic recipe, but sure to be loved by all!
Serves: 1 9-inch pie, approx 8 servings
Ingredients
  • Ingredients:
  • Two-Crust Pie (my recipe can be found here)
  • 3 cans pitted, tart pie cherries, drained
  • 10 teaspoons corn starch
  • 1 and ¾ cups sugar
  • 3 Tablespoons lemon juice
  • ½ teaspoon almond extract
  • 3 Tablespoons butter
Instructions
  1.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Prepare 9-inch pie plate (I used a deep dish) with pie crust.
  2. In a medium, non-aluminum saucepan, combine cherries, sugar and cornstarch.
  3. Let sit for 10 minutes.
  4. Over medium heat, bring cherry mixture to a boil, stirring constantly.
  5. Add lemon juice, almond extract and butter.
  6. Stir until combined, and immediately pour into pie crust. Top with additional pie crust, pinch crust to seal and cut slits on the top of the pie.
  7. Bake for 45 - 55 minutes, using foil or a pie shield to prevent crust from over-browning.
  8. Cool to room temperature, then serve.
